There has been talk of a revolution in the field of for some time now iPadsince the devices have not yet seen a screen on their side OLED, designed to be the best in contrasts, black levels and true-to-life color reproduction, with news in this sense that could arrive in a short time. Apparently yes, either LG That Samsung are ready to provide the Cupertino giant with the screens of the iPad OLEDthe first of the behemoth, which should be 11 and 12.9-inch models.

A report from the Elec explained the fact that Samsung screen would probably be able to mass-produce 8.5-generation OLED panels for second-generation iPads by the end of 2024, although it is not certain that the South Korean company will be in charge of this task, with a fairly short decision that could come by the end of July 2022.

None of this contrasts with what has been expected so far, and there is the possibility that Apple will also be able to leverage this type of 8.5-generation technology for more and more devices, with the iPads would be the first to receive an update of this type in hardware, with major improvements also in graphics.

Analyst Ross Young also confirmed Apple’s interest in the world of OLEDs even outside the field of iPhones, although there is still no news in this sense, officially and the company has not commented on it in any way, hoping that in a while there will be a way to handle the following devices announce.
